Facility insight: WILCOX GAS PLANT
WILCOX GAS PLANT (GHGRP ID 1002029) is a high-volume reporter at 143K MT CO₂e in 2023 from Hallettsville, TX (#2,073 of 8,713 nationally) under Natural Gas and Natural Gas Liquids Suppliers (NAICS 211130).
Over 13 years (2011–2023), emissions stayed within a narrow band around 143K MT CO₂e (peak 165K MT). This facility has filed every year from 2011 to 2023, a complete 13-year record.
Peak year was 2019 at 165K MT CO2e; latest 2023 sits 13.5% below that peak (143K MT). The largest year-to-year move was 2017→2018 (+26.8%, 34K MT).
